Assignment: Using evidence from the film Deep Earth explain how human history has been shaped by plate tectonics. Write an essay titled How have plate tectonics shaped human history?
Introduction: Explain what the inside of the Earth is like. What are plates and why do they move? Evidence: Write 4 paragraphs. The first one should explain how early people benefitted from plate tectonics. The second will describe how plate tectonics led to the Minoan civilization growing rich and powerful. In paragraph three you should describe the way in which plate tectonics ruined the Minoans. Finally you should write about the advantages and disadvantages that plate tectonics have brought to California. Conclusion: To end your essay you should refer back to the title. Think about these ideas: 1) What are the most important ways in which people have been affected by plate tectonics? 2) Do the benefits of plate tectonics outweigh the disadvantages? 3) What can we learn from Istanbul about how humans might be affected in the future by plate tectonics?
